Is group Dhikr, even if it is "La ilaha illa Allah" (There is no god but Allah), considered an innovation (bid'ah)?
Collective dhikr in one voice is an innovation (bid‘ah) because it was not reported from the Prophet (peace be upon him) nor his Companions. Had it been good, they would have preceded us to it.
Gathering to remember Allah is desirable and legislated, but it is not permissible for it to be in an innovative manner. Indeed, Ibn Mas‘ud denounced a group he saw remembering Allah in a way he had not known.
